PROCESSES OF SELF-ORGANIZATION IN THE CHAOTIC AND DYNAMIC SYSTEMS

Journal Title: World Science - Year 2017, Vol 2, Issue 7

Abstract

Not long ago, scientists thought that complex chaotic movement can only be created only in some multidimensional systems, but it turned out that it is also possible in nonlinear deterministic third rank systems. The processes that are common in nonlinear dynamic systems belong are chaotic. Mathematical models of such processes contain polynomial and quadratic nonlinearity that are widespread in objects with different nature. Because of these objects, the problem for controlling of chaotic processes that gets more and more attention within scientific literature.
